Fresno Air Quality in May

Across 2019–2025, Fresno's May air quality had a median AQI of 57 (Moderate) over 217 monitored days in the Fresno, CA area. 11.1% of May days (24 of 217) reached Unhealthy for Sensitive Groups or worse, and ground-level ozone set the daily AQI on 89.4% of days. The cleanest May on record here was 2019 (median AQI 51, 2 days above 100) and the worst was 2025 (median 64, 5 days above 100, peak AQI 164).

What May air means in Fresno

A typical May day in Fresno is Moderate (median AQI 57): outdoor exercise is acceptable for most people, but unusually sensitive individuals should watch for symptoms, and about 1 day in 9 of May days (11.1%) reached AQI 101+ — the level at which EPA advises people with asthma, children and older adults to shorten hard outdoor exertion.

May's median AQI of 57 is below Fresno's whole-year median of 67, making it one of the area's cleaner periods. Nationally, the median May AQI across every EPA metro area (104,064 metro-days, 2019–2025) is 44, so Fresno runs above the national May norm; 11.1% of its May days topped AQI 100 versus 1.3% nationally (above average).

Source: EPA Air Quality System (AQS) pre-generated Daily AQI by CBSA files — daily AQI by CBSA (Fresno, CA), 2019–2025. Daily AQI per CBSA is the highest AQI reported by any monitor in the area that day; the defining parameter is the pollutant that set it. Month and season statistics pool every such day in the period across all years listed. Retrieved 2026-09-09.
